Dist-upgrade a Debian system from Knoppix
My new Debian system won't connect to the internet (as seen in another post) to apt-get dist-upgrade. I was hoping there would be an easy way to download all of the .deb files on a new Debian system to my Debian partition from Knoppix (which can connect to the internet). Once I have a full system it should be a breeze to get the network working Debian. Any ideas?

No you cannot do a dist-upgrade using knoppix and then somehow load it on your debian install. Even if you did it would not magically "make" the internet work since according to the other thread your network card should be fine you just need to get the network setup correctly.
If you are going to do anything then give Debian Etch a try. Download the full etch CD1 and use it. It as a easier installer that may help you get your network setup correctly.
